The phrase "a key differentiating factor"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when discussing an important element that distinguishes one thing from another, often in a comparative context.
Example: "In the competitive market, customer service is a key differentiating factor that sets our company apart from others."
Alternatives: "a crucial distinguishing element" or "a significant differentiator".
